The Importance of Prayer
In Islam, prayer Salah is one of the Five Pillars and serves as a direct link between the believer and Allah God. Performing the five daily prayers at designated times helps Muslims engage in reflection, gratitude, and worship throughout the day. These prayers are as follows
1. Fajr in New Waterford This early morning prayer marks the beginning of the day. It is performed before dawn, capturing a peaceful moment to seek guidance and blessings for the day ahead.
2. Sunrise in New Waterford While not an official prayer, the sunrise is significant as it marks the end of Fajr. This is a beautiful time to witness the dawn and reflect on the beauty of creation.
3. Dhuhr in New Waterford The Dhuhr prayer is performed just after the sun passes its zenith. It serves as a midday retreat, providing an opportunity to pause and reconnect with ones faith during a busy day.
4. Asr in New Waterford This afternoon prayer occurs in the late part of the day. It is a reminder of the passage of time and the importance of staying grounded in faith amidst daily activities.
5. Maghrib in New Waterford Maghrib is performed just after sunset, symbolizing the end of the days labor and the beginning of the evening. It is often a time for families to gather and break their fast during Ramadan.
6. Isha in New Waterford The night prayer, Isha, is performed after twilight has disappeared. It concludes the day with a sense of peace and wraps up the days acknowledgment of faith.
